An electronic oscillator is an electronic circuit that produces a periodic, oscillating electronic signal, often a sine wave or a square wave.[1]

Oscillators are often characterized by the frequency of their output signal:

  • low-frequency oscillator (LFO) is an electronic oscillator that generates a frequency below ≈20 Hz. This term is typically used in the field of audio synthesizers, to distinguish it from an audio frequency oscillator.
  • An audio oscillator produces frequencies in the audio range, about 16 Hz to 20 kHz.[2]
  • An RF oscillator produces signals in the radio frequency (RF) range of about 100 kHz to 100 GHz.[2]

Oscillators designed to produce a high-power AC output from a DC supply are usually called inverters.

电子振荡器英语:electronic oscillator)是用来产生具有周期性的模拟信号(通常是正弦波方波)的电子电路[1]

振荡器通常用他们输出信号的频率描述:

  • 低频振荡器low-frequency oscillator, LFO)是指产生频率在20 kHz以下的(有的定义在0.1到10赫兹之间)交流信号振荡器。它通常用在音讯合成器中,用来区别其他的音讯振荡器。
  • 音频振荡器产生频率在音频范围内,约16 Hz到20 kHz。[2]
  • 射频振荡器产生的信号在射频(RF)范围内,约100 kHz至100 GHz。[2]

用来由直流电源产生高功率交流输出的振荡器通常称为逆变器

振荡器主要可以分成以下两种:谐波振荡器(harmonic oscillator)与弛张振荡器relaxation oscillator)。
